    Remote Keys

    Remote key fobs allow you to lock and unlock your vehicle without using physical keys. The key fobs transmit radio frequency signals to connect with the receiver modules that are in your car. If your fobs cease to function it could mean that there is a problem in your vehicle or with the remote keyfob itself.

    The most common reason for a key fob that isn't working is a dead coin battery, which is replaced in just minutes. However, the issue could be caused by worn buttons, faulty contact with the battery, water damage, receiver module problems, signal interference, or a malfunctioning electronic chip.

    If the keys were exposed to water prior to it was time to ensure they are dry before using them again. If your key fob has survived being in the pool or washing machine take it off and clean the internal components with isopropyl or electronic cleaner. If the fob has microchips, you'll have to reprogram it using an OBDII scan or at an skoda rapid key replacement dealership.

    If the keys are reprogrammed but still do not work, it's likely to be a malfunctioning module. This is particularly true if the keys worked well prior to that, but suddenly stopped functioning. You can diagnose this problem by connecting an OBDII scanner to the vehicle and entering the information of the vehicle. The majority of scan tools will require the vehicle's model, make, model, and engine type.

    Key Fobs

    If your key fob stops working, there could be several reasons for it. The most common reason is a dead coin battery inside the key fob that you can replace in a few minutes. If you've replaced your battery but it still doesn’t work, there may be a second issue.

    In some cases the signal of the key fob can be disrupted by weather conditions, objects or transmitters on the same frequency band close to your vehicle. If you notice a problem you can remove the interference by moving further away from the source. If this doesn't help then you should seek out an auto repair shop near you to restore the signal.

    Another reason why your key fob might not be working is a broken chip. This can happen if you drop the key fob into water or if it accidentally goes through the washer. It's important to keep it in mind that key fobs aren't waterproof, so if you drop it into water, make sure to take the battery off and then clean the electronic component with isopropyl alcohol, or an electronics cleaner before putting it back.

    To change the battery in your key fob, you must remove the cover by removing the front part with a screwdriver. Then lift the cover out of the area marked by an arrow. Unscrew the flat battery and then replace it with a different one. Make sure the + symbol is facing upwards.
